    (A) Gold and silver in the are are not pure state, but they are alloyed with certain metals, mostly Au-Ag and Ag-S. The proper concentration of cyanide solution for dissolution of gold and silver in these alloyed states was obtained by expeiments as follows:
    For Au-Ag alloys containing 10-20% Ag, 0.1-0.2% KCN,
    For Au-Ag alloys containing 30-50% Ag, 0.2% KCN,
    For Ag-S alloy containing 13% S, 0.35% or more KCN.
    (B) To promote the dissolving power of cyanide solution, the writer invented the next improved cyanide process (Japanese Patent No. 127, 164): 0.005-0.5% of bleaching powder to gold are is added to the cyanide solution, the addition of 0.01-0.02% of bleaching powder being most effective for ordinary ores.
    The results obtained by the improved cyanide process applied to Au-Ag, Ag-S, Au and Ag are as follows:-
    1. The dissolution of Au-Ag alloy containing 10% Ag by 0.10% NaCN solution is remarkably promoted by adding 0.02-0.03% of bleaching powder, but it is interrupted by adding 0.08% or more of bleaching powder.
    2. The dissolution of Ag-S alloy containing 13% S by 0.3% KCN solution becomes maximum when 0.03% of bleaching powder is added, but the dissolving power is weakened by adding 0.04% or more of bleaching powder.
    3. The addition of bleaching powder up to 0.08% to 0.25% KCN solution does not effect upon the solubility of pure gold, but the addition of bleaching powder more than 0.08% gives bad effects.
    4. The dissolution of pure silver by 0.25% KCN solution becomes maximum when 0.02% of bleaching powder is added, but it is weakened by adding 0.08% or more of bleaching powder.
    From the above experiments, it may be concluded that the addition of a small quantity of bleaching powder to cyanide solution aids the dissolution of silver and silver alloys such as Ag-Au, Ag-S, etc., and, therefore, this improved cyanide process acts effectively upon the gold and the silver in ores.
    The new process was applied to the gold ores of Sizukari, Motikosi and Kamiyosi Mines in laboratory experiments, and the next results were obtained.
    The new process was applied to 100 ton plant at Huke, Japan, for the dissolution of flotation concentrate. By the addition of bleaching powder of 0.02% to flotation concentrate into the agitation tank, 99.3% of the gold and 94.4% of the silver were dissolved. The differences of dissolution % before and after the application of bleaching powder are 1.4% in gold and 17.2% in silver.
